Antelope Valley Environmental Collection Center

To increase the recycling capacity of Palmdale, Waste Management encourages residents to drop off items at the Antelope Valley Environmental Collection Center (AVECC). Funded entirely by a “2001/2002 Used Oil Opportunity Grant” from the California Integrated Waste Management Board (CIWMB), the $700,000 facility is the area’s first permanent Environmental Collection Center. This residential special material collection facility will serve the needs of Antelope Valley residents for free, helping to discourage the improper disposal of household wastes that can endanger our community and environment.

At the AVECC residents can dispose of Household Hazardous Waste (e.g., paint, oil and batteries), as well as old electronics (e.g., TVs, monitors, computers and printers).
